• Winchester sets deadline for retiring with Medicare reimbursement (winchesternews.org) — Winchester has set June 30, 2027, as the last day town employees can retire and still receive the $200-per-month Medicare Part B reimbursement in retirement. The Select Board's decision could influence when 88 retirement-eligible staff choose to leave and will affect future town budgets, vacation and sick-time payouts, and how departments plan for staffing and succession over the next two years.
